Output ffb195da41f2eb26eceec21131ca7aa709151b54854a4e6b385834feef39381e:0

value
662430
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ab2d73d1cf9f571a72dc468390a33335543065b9cf75ec51e536f9cdf6c8ecdd
address
bc1p4vkh85w0nat35ukug6pepgenx42rqedeea67c509xmuumakganws3m9szp
transaction
ffb195da41f2eb26eceec21131ca7aa709151b54854a4e6b385834feef39381e
confirmations
17529
spent
true